Q: Is 1,125,870 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,125,870 is a composite number.

Why is 1,125,870 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,125,870 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 37,529 75,058 112,587 187,645 225,174 375,290 562,935 and 1,125,870, with no remainder.

Since 1,125,870 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,125,870, it is a composite number.
